    Pam . . . you left out the fact that you are a therapist of sorts so you would be able to be a bit more introspective. I agree there is no rush to seek out a gender identity therapist if you are just questioning/toying with the idea. But if you are truly in a chaotic state of mind (BTDT got the t-shirt) a good therapist can help bring order to chaos and guide you down the path. Just because a person thinks they are TS does not mean they are and if you don't have the ability to be introspective . . . well just saying . . . you could make some life altering decisions which might not have been the appropriate choice.

    So my take . . . some people know from the beginning and don't require a therapist to bring them to that decision others . . . need a guiding hand. Nothing wrong with that.
